Berberine inhibits hepatic gluconeogenesisviathe LKB1-AMPK-TORC2 signaling pathway in streptozotocin-induced diabetic rats

To investigate the molecular mechanisms of berberine inhibition of hepatic gluconeogenesis in a diabetic rat model.
